Review: 'Film Stars Don't Die in Liverpool' Shares a Last-Gasp Romance
New York Times Unfolding during the final years in the life of the actress Gloria Grahame (who died in 1981), the movie recounts her unlikely last-gasp love affair with Mr. Turner, an English actor. When they met, in a London boardinghouse in 1978, he was 26 and she ...
